Output 673bb7856095b181f35280a5591f30bfe73107e25ee4b03ee313f1c3022e0662:29

value
277000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a76ad6087d8104a634d690b7aca42765d74bd74e OP_EQUAL
address
3GxEkgN7skXpW7suN9aZNofJQWqtGzP9xA
transaction
673bb7856095b181f35280a5591f30bfe73107e25ee4b03ee313f1c3022e0662
confirmations
201715
spent
true